Output 34623ca08e5af59a7f812f3e93f372d7374a1de2ce53ae99984365299c7e791f:8

value
20583862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9245c457f553b907b92723f7dd9ebdaa1ba4920 OP_EQUAL
address
3QQMjgDFkwQxFDf2cdqZR27DerdyyibDzx
transaction
34623ca08e5af59a7f812f3e93f372d7374a1de2ce53ae99984365299c7e791f
spent
true